What Are Vector Images?

Vector images are digital graphics composed of mathematical formulas that define shapes, lines, and curves. These images maintain their quality at any size, making them ideal for various design applications.

Vector vs. Raster Images

Vector images differ significantly from raster images in their structure and scalability. While raster images are made up of pixels, vector images consist of paths defined by mathematical equations. This fundamental difference results in several key advantages for vector images:

  • Scalability: Vector images can be resized infinitely without losing quality or becoming pixelated.
  • File size: Vector files are typically smaller than raster files, especially for large images.
  • Editability: Each element in a vector image can be individually modified without affecting the rest of the image.
  • Precision: Vector images offer precise control over shapes and lines, making them perfect for logos and technical drawings.

Raster images, on the other hand, have fixed resolutions and lose quality when enlarged beyond their original size. They’re better suited for photographs and complex images with many color variations.

Common Vector File Formats

Vector images come in various file formats, each with its own characteristics and uses:

  1. AI (Adobe Illustrator):
  • Native format for Adobe Illustrator
  • Offers advanced editing capabilities
  • Widely used in professional design workflows
  1. EPS (Encapsulated PostScript):
  • Compatible with many design programs
  • Preserves image quality across different software
  1. SVG (Scalable Vector Graphics):
  • Web-friendly format
  • Supports interactivity and animation
  • Ideal for responsive web design
  1. PDF (Portable Document Format):
  • Universal format for sharing and printing
  • Can contain both vector and raster elements

When working with vector images, it’s essential to choose the appropriate format based on your specific needs and the intended use of the image. For instance, SVG is an excellent choice for web graphics, while AI or EPS might be preferred for print projects.

Free vs. Paid Options

Vector graphics software options range from free to premium, each with distinct advantages:

Free options:

  • Inkscape: Open-source software with a comprehensive feature set
  • SVG-edit: Browser-based editor for basic vector creation
  • Gravit Designer: Cloud-based tool with both free and paid tiers

Paid options:

  • Adobe Illustrator: Industry-standard software with advanced features
  • CorelDRAW: Powerful tool popular in print and manufacturing industries
  • Affinity Designer: Cost-effective alternative with professional-grade capabilities

Consider your budget, project requirements, and skill level when choosing between free and paid options. While free software can be suitable for beginners or occasional use, paid options often offer more advanced features and regular updates for professional work.

Working with Bezier Curves

Bezier curves form the backbone of vector graphics. To master them:

  • Use anchor points and handles to shape curves precisely
  • Practice creating smooth transitions between curve segments
  • Experiment with symmetrical and asymmetrical curves for diverse shapes
  • Utilize the Convert Anchor Point tool to switch between smooth and corner points

Remember, fewer anchor points often result in smoother curves. Start with minimal points and add more as needed for complex shapes.

Creating Gradients and Patterns

Gradients and patterns add depth and texture to vector designs:

  • Linear gradients: Create smooth color transitions across an object
  • Radial gradients: Generate circular color blends from a central point
  • Mesh gradients: Apply multi-color gradients for complex shading
  • Repeating patterns: Design custom patterns to fill shapes or backgrounds

Experiment with opacity and blending modes to achieve unique effects with gradients and patterns.

Using Blending Modes

Blending modes offer creative ways to combine vector objects:

  • Multiply: Darkens overlapping areas, ideal for shadow effects
  • Screen: Lightens overlapping areas, perfect for highlights
  • Overlay: Enhances contrast while preserving highlights and shadows
  • Color Dodge: Brightens the base color using the blend color

Apply blending modes to individual objects or groups to create complex visual effects and enhance depth in your vector compositions.

Tips for Vector Image Success

Common Mistakes to Avoid

  • Overcomplicating designs: Keep vector designs clean and simple. Complex designs with too many anchor points can lead to rendering issues and file size bloat.
  • Neglecting proper layering: Organize elements into logical layers for easier editing and management.
  • Ignoring color modes: Use RGB for digital projects and CMYK for print to ensure accurate color reproduction.
  • Forgetting to outline fonts: Convert text to outlines before sharing files to prevent font compatibility issues.
  • Scaling unevenly: Maintain aspect ratios when resizing to avoid distorted images.

Troubleshooting Common Issues

Fixing Distorted Shapes

Vector images appear distorted when imported into other software. To fix this issue:

  1. Check file compatibility: Ensure the vector format is supported by the destination software
  2. Verify scaling settings: Confirm uniform scaling is applied to maintain proportions
  3. Update software: Install the latest version of your vector editing program for improved compatibility

Resolving Color Discrepancies

Colors in vector images sometimes display differently across devices or software. Address this problem by:

  1. Standardize color profiles: Use consistent color profiles like sRGB or Adobe RGB
  2. Convert to CMYK: Switch to CMYK color mode for print projects
  3. Test on multiple devices: View the image on different screens to ensure consistency

Dealing with Missing Fonts

Text in vector images may appear incorrectly due to missing fonts. Solve this by:

  1. Outline text: Convert text to outlines before sharing the file
  2. Embed fonts: Include necessary fonts within the vector file when possible
  3. Use common fonts: Opt for widely available fonts to minimize compatibility issues

Handling Large File Sizes

Vector files become excessively large, causing slow performance. Reduce file size by:

  1. Simplify complex paths: Remove unnecessary anchor points and smooth curves
  2. Use symbols: Create symbols for repeated elements to reduce redundancy
  3. Compress images: Optimize any embedded raster images within the vector file

Addressing Export Problems

Difficulties arise when exporting vector images to other formats. Resolve export issues by:

  1. Check export settings: Ensure proper resolution and format settings for the intended use
  2. Use appropriate file format: Select the correct vector format (e.g., SVG for web, AI for print)
  3. Flatten transparency: Merge transparent layers before exporting to avoid unexpected results
